javascript、Web页面设计开发
文章平均质量分 74
redleaf1995
这个作者很懒,什么都没留下…
展开
-
IE7中将页面"设为首页"的新变化
以前版本的“设为首页”代码,非常简单,如点击按钮,将其设为首页的代码为:a class="chlnk" style="cursor:hand" HREF="#" onClick="this.style.behavior=url(#default#homepage);this.setHomePage(http://blog.csdn.net/redleaf1995);return f原创 2007-05-14 07:35:00 · 1609 阅读 · 2 评论 -
Firefox解析CDATA的问题
这段xml语句,在IE中通过,并能显示出内容,但在Firefox中不提示出错,却在网页怎么也显示不出内容:text> …. ]]>text>调试的最后结果,竟然是这两个必须放在同一原创 2008-01-18 19:15:00 · 905 阅读 · 0 评论 -
使用javascript操纵HTML元素的自定义属性
为HTML元素添加一自定义的属性非常方便,只须将其加到尖括号中即可,与内置属性地位相等。如我们要为TextBox元素添加属性idvalue:input type="text" id="txtInput" name="txtInput" value="自定义文本">只须在原来的控件后面加上:idvalue=”…”,成为:input type="text" id="txtI原创 2008-01-18 18:52:00 · 4926 阅读 · 0 评论 -
什么是XForms
HTML表单,如:email表单和订购表单,都是网站重要的组成部分。如果没有表单,网络管理员就不能从访问者那里收集信息,并接受在线信用卡服 务,要知道,这可是电子商务的核心啊。想想看,如果一个网站只是展示了大量的图片,却没有可以用于业务交流和业务联系的方式,那么这个网站还有用处可言 吗?至今为止,互联网差不多已经走过了10年光景,HTML表单也开始变的过时和陈旧了。现在,网站所有者们对表单的需转载 2008-04-02 10:41:00 · 1617 阅读 · 0 评论 -
ASP.NET页面中window.open方法对history对象的影响及解决
在ASP.NET页面中,如果想返回前一页面。可以调用javascript的window.history.back()方法。这种方法在大部分情况下是有效的,但是如果界面中有按钮等控件执行了window.open()的javascript方法来打开其它页面后,window.history.back()方法就不太好用了,原因是javascript将打开的页面地址也保存进了history对象。所以执行了若原创 2008-04-09 13:49:00 · 1816 阅读 · 0 评论 -
[转]WebService优点和缺点小结
最近做的几个项目都用到了webservice,通过自己的实践和网上资料的汇总,现在做个小结: 当前WebService是一个热门话题。但是,WebService究竟是什么?,WebService有什么优点和缺点,什么情况下应该用WebService?什么情况下不应该用WebService?是需要我们正确认识的。 实际上,WebService的主要目标是跨平台的可互转载 2008-04-08 11:49:00 · 1174 阅读 · 0 评论 -
用javascript实现既能禁止页面鼠标右键查看 同时又能查看页面文本框右键菜单
刚才在CSDN上,看到有人问这个问题。就是若把页面右键屏蔽的话,文本框上的右键菜单同样也给屏蔽,问如何能够将文本框的右键菜单显示出来。解决思路:首先,要在页面初始化时将页面右键菜单屏蔽其次,在欲解除右键限制的文本框获得焦点时,启用页面document的右键菜单。可以用在文本框中的onmousedown事件中,但推荐用在onfocus事件中,若使用的onmousedown的话,则按键盘上摸拟右键的按原创 2008-04-07 15:28:00 · 1317 阅读 · 0 评论 -
CSS入门
1.基本语法规范分析一个典型CSS的语句:p {COLOR:#FF0000;BACKGROUND:#FFFFFF} 其中"p"我们称为"选择器"(selectors),指明我们要给"p"定义样式;样式声明写在一对大括号"{}"中;COLOR和BACKGROUND称为"属性"(property),不同属性之间用分号";"分隔;"#FF0000"和"#FFFFFF"是属性的值(value)。2.颜色值转载 2008-04-02 10:57:00 · 1041 阅读 · 0 评论 -
[转]javascript小技巧(非常全)
事件源对象 event.srcElement.tagName event.srcElement.type 捕获释放 event.srcElement.setCapture(); event.srcElement.releaseCapture(); 事件按键 event.keyCode event.shiftKey event.altKey event.ct转载 2008-03-27 18:09:00 · 3766 阅读 · 0 评论 -
javascript中验证日期和日期时间格式
在javascript中,我们经常要对日期格式加以判断,用正则表达式是最为快捷有效的,下面是验证日期格式(YYYY-MM-DD)和日期时间格式(YYYY-MM-DD hh:mm:ss)的正则表达式.var _reDataTime = /^([1-9]d...{3}-((0?[1-9])|(1[0-2]))-((0[1-9])|([1-2]?d)|(3[0-1])))?$/ //日期原创 2008-03-26 15:05:00 · 2304 阅读 · 0 评论 -
一个javascript写的media player播放器
界面较为简单,支持播放列表 。建立播放列表的步骤为:1)在文本框中输入媒体资源的地址,可以是HTTP地址,相对地址和绝对地址2)点击“添加到媒体列表”按钮,将媒体资源信息放到媒体列表中3)在媒体列表中,点击“添加”链接,将媒体加入到播放列表中4)重复若干遍,加入所有歌曲5)点击“播放选中的歌曲“,就开始播放 播放列表中的所有打勾的媒体文件完整代码如下:script language="J原创 2008-03-12 18:23:00 · 2879 阅读 · 2 评论 -
setCapture和releaseCapture的小应用
web开发和windows开发最大的区别就是windows开发是有状态的,而web开发是无状态的,在windows中,一切操作都可以由程序来控制 ,除非强制执行ctrl+alt+del;但web操作就不一样了,即使执行很重要的操作,用户一点击浏览器关闭按钮,就将前面操作成果化为乌有.尽管可以在onunload事件中加些代码,让用户可以选择是否退出,但不能从根本上解决问题!原创 2008-03-06 18:19:00 · 9686 阅读 · 6 评论 -
HTML学习笔记:图像标记
图像标记 Web上常用的图像格式有三种:JPEG、GIF、PNG。使用在网页上加入图像的语法: 不需要结束标记,只需在开始标记里设置属性即可。的常用属性有: (1)src:用来设定图像文件的路径,可以是相对路径或绝对路径。 (2)alt:用来设定只显示文本的浏览器或已设置为手动下载图像的浏览器中代替图像显示的替代文本 (3)height:用来设定图像的高度 (4)width:用来设定图像的宽原创 2008-02-21 16:36:00 · 1721 阅读 · 0 评论 -
用javascript定义和操作自定义HTML元素
前面的文章探讨了使用javascript来操纵HTML元素的自定义属性,那么在HTML页面中,除了系统支持的HTML元素外,是否可以建立自定义的HTML元素呢?答案是可以的。自定义的HTML元素与系统自身的HTML元素地位相同,都可以用document.getElementById来获得,区别在于,自定义的HTML元素都是不可见的,类似于隐藏控件。使用自定义HTML元素,我们就可以建立多种隐藏控件,而不一定拘泥于只能建立input的hidden元素了;另外,还可以用于某些特定方面的需求!原创 2008-02-21 16:36:00 · 996 阅读 · 0 评论 -
纯javascript的HTML在线编辑器
因工作需要,需使用javascript来操作HTML在线编辑器,在网上搜了许多,都是与服务器端相结合的,通过表单提交的方式来处理的。没办法,只好在此基础上对其进行更新! 参考的myeditor控件不知是哪位高人写的。在此表示感谢!首先,定义一全局变量,用于向HtmlEditor传递值:var EDITOR_DEFAULT_VALUE = ""; //全局变原创 2008-01-30 15:58:00 · 3577 阅读 · 0 评论 -
javascript中的自定义属性的应用--避免频繁访问数据库
在WEB应用程序中,经常需要将数据从数据库中取出来,填充到HTML控件中,然后再存回数据库。如果数据并未改动,仍然占用网络资源存入数据库,则对网络资源是一种浪费,当页面数据很多和网络访问量很大时,就会形成性能的瓶颈。如何能在提交数据前进行判断呢?一种方法是建隐藏控件或定义全局变量,这种情况适用于控件很少时,若一个表单页面有数十项时,建隐藏控件太多反而降低性能,定义全局变量不容易记忆。另原创 2008-01-29 19:09:00 · 1447 阅读 · 0 评论 -
用javascript添加控件自定义属性
前面说过为HTML元素添加自定义的属性,是通过手动在HTML控件中加上,其实可以在javascript中动态添加:如有一文本框:input type="text" id="txtInput" name="txtInput" value="自定义文本">如想增加idvalue属性(值为”自定义值”),可以在javascript中这样写:var txt = document.g原创 2008-01-29 18:58:00 · 4207 阅读 · 0 评论 -
Javascript - Select操作大集合
最 近在看一本书,Wrox.Professional JavaScript™ for Web Developers,是老赵在他的Ajax深入浅出系列讲座中提到过的一本书。其实这本书一直都在我的电脑里,只是没认真看过。一直没怎么很正式的学习 过javascript,偶尔用到的时候就到网上找些代码,改吧改吧就用了,这次从头开始学起,细细看下来,还真是有不少收获,甚至有点喜欢上 javascr转载 2008-04-25 10:33:00 · 873 阅读 · 0 评论